The Harry Potter Wiki doesn't have a redirect button in the edit bar. Any idea why? John Reaves 07:44, 2 January 2007 (UTC)
- The redirect button isn't a standard MediaWiki button, but something the Wikipedians have added on their own via Javascript (along with about a dozen others). They are added via Wikipedia:MediaWiki:Common.js in the section "Extra toolbar options" and are considered experimental. The method they use to insert them requires a newer version of MediaWiki than we currently have (using mwCustomEditButtons[] in wikibits.js). --Splarka (talk) 07:51, 2 January 2007 (UTC)

I'd like to ask how you make an inter-wiki link. --Wikada - Talk Contributions 20:28, 4 January 2007 (UTC)
- For links to other wikis, see Interwiki map for the prefix. Basically, it would the [[Prefix:Page]]. For interwiki links within Wikia, the syntax is [[w:c:name_of_wiki:Page]]. The name_of_wiki is basically the subdomain, as in http://name_of_wiki.wikia.com. G.He(Talk!) 20:36, 4 January 2007 (UTC)
- You can also use a single parameter (|), created by pressing shift+backwards slash (\), to hide the interlinking. For example, [[:Wikipedia:Wikia|Wikia]] yields Wikia. John Reaves 22:23, 4 January 2007 (UTC)

Do you know how to change a logo on any MediaWiki site without uploading it as Wiki.png? --Tegiiis 23:45, 14 January 2007 (UTC)
- If you mean a Wikia site, that's the only way to do it. For non-Wikia sites, you need to set the location of the image in LocalSettings.php. Angela talk 00:48, 15 January 2007 (UTC)
Do you know how to set them in LocalSettings.php? --Tegiiis 02:37, 15 January 2007 (UTC)
- Is this for a wiki you host yourself? If so, just add $wgLogo = '/path/to/your/logo.png';. I suggest you read the m:MediaWiki FAQ. If you're talking about a wiki hosted by someone else, you should talk to them about how to do this. Angela talk 03:14, 15 January 2007 (UTC)
